문제

Netmon을 사용하여 DB의 트래픽 (B, KB, MB, GB)을 모니터링 할 수 있다고 생각하지만 트래픽 크기의 요약 및 고장을 얻는 방법을 모르겠습니다.

누구든지 Netmon을 사용하여 이것을 사용했으며 올바른 방향으로 나를 설명 할 수 있습니다.

내 시나리오에서 모든 것이 현지인이므로 DB 호출의 대역폭 사용법을 알고 싶습니다.

도움이 되었습니까?

해결책

특정 쿼리에서 전송/수신 된 바이트를 찾으려고합니까, 또는 주어진 하중 하에서 모든 쿼리에 사용되는 대역폭의 양을 찾으려고합니까?

단일 쿼리에 대해 전송/수신 된 바이트에 대한 아이디어를 얻으려면 SQL Management Studio의 쿼리 메뉴에서 "클라이언트 통계 포함"을 켜십시오.

로드에서 네트워크 사용량을 보려면 가장 쉬운 방법은 다른 컴퓨터에서로드를 생성 한 다음 DB 서버에서 Perfmon을 사용하고 실제 활용을 모니터링하기 위해 전송/수신 된 네트워크 인터페이스의 바이트에 대한 카운터를 추가하는 것입니다.

하나의 컴퓨터로 제한되면 단일 프로세스 네트워크 트래픽을 분리 할 수있는 것을 시도 할 수 있습니다. netlimiter

다른 팁

ado.net에서 sqlconnection을 사용하는 경우 제공자 통계 수신 및 전송 된 총 바이트 수를 얻기 위해.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top